没有合适的资源?快使用搜索试试~ 我知道了~
基于UVM验证平台Makefile
需积分: 50 79 下载量 55 浏览量
2018-07-12
10:21:25
上传
评论 6
收藏 1KB TXT 举报
温馨提示
试读
2页
基于UVM验证平台Makefile,支持通用,需提供独特dut.f tb.f这两个filelist
资源推荐
资源详情
资源评论
.PHONY help
output_dir := debug
exec_dir := $(output_dir)/exec
log_dir := $(output_dir)/log
wave_dir :=$(output_dir)/wave
cov_dir := $(output_dir)/cov
tc :=
seed :=
wave:=
cov:=
rtl_src := -f dut.f
tb_src := -f tb.f
cmp_opts := -sverilog +v2k +libsxt+.v+.vh +nospecify +notimingcheck +plag_save -full64 -debug_access+all -timescale=1ns/1ps -unit_timescale=1ns/1ps +vcs+lic+wait -ntb_opts uvm-1.1
cmp_opts += $(rtl_src) $(tb_src)
ifeq ($(wave),fsdb))
cmp_opts += +define+FSDB -fsdb
endif
ifeq ($(cov),on)
cmp_opts += -cm line|cond|fsm|tgl -cm_dir $(cov_dir)/cov.vdb
endif
ifeq ($(seed),)
seed = $(shell perl -e 'print int(rand(10000000))')
endif
exec_file := $(exec_dir)/simv
cmp_opts += -o $(exec_file) -Mdir=$(exec_dir)/csrc -l $(log_dir)/compile.log
run_opts := +UVM_TESTNAME=$(tc) +ntb_random_seed=$(seed) -l $(log_dir)/$(tc)_$(seed).run_log
output_dir := debug
exec_dir := $(output_dir)/exec
log_dir := $(output_dir)/log
wave_dir :=$(output_dir)/wave
cov_dir := $(output_dir)/cov
tc :=
seed :=
wave:=
cov:=
rtl_src := -f dut.f
tb_src := -f tb.f
cmp_opts := -sverilog +v2k +libsxt+.v+.vh +nospecify +notimingcheck +plag_save -full64 -debug_access+all -timescale=1ns/1ps -unit_timescale=1ns/1ps +vcs+lic+wait -ntb_opts uvm-1.1
cmp_opts += $(rtl_src) $(tb_src)
ifeq ($(wave),fsdb))
cmp_opts += +define+FSDB -fsdb
endif
ifeq ($(cov),on)
cmp_opts += -cm line|cond|fsm|tgl -cm_dir $(cov_dir)/cov.vdb
endif
ifeq ($(seed),)
seed = $(shell perl -e 'print int(rand(10000000))')
endif
exec_file := $(exec_dir)/simv
cmp_opts += -o $(exec_file) -Mdir=$(exec_dir)/csrc -l $(log_dir)/compile.log
run_opts := +UVM_TESTNAME=$(tc) +ntb_random_seed=$(seed) -l $(log_dir)/$(tc)_$(seed).run_log
资源评论
rubenson
- 粉丝: 1
- 资源: 2
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功